Missouri's Unpredictable Fronts: Protecting Your Roof
Located right in the transition zone of the Midwest, Missouri roofs endure massive temperature swings. A single week can bring heavy spring rain, blistering heat, and sudden freezes. This constant expansion and contraction is the leading cause of failed roof flashing and chimney leaks.
Common Missouri Roofing Threats
Our local professionals understand the unique geographic and meteorological challenges your home faces.
Rapid Freeze-Thaw Cycles
Causes metal roof flashing around chimneys and skylights to expand, contract, and break their watertight seals.
Ozark & Valley Wind Tunnels
Geographic wind funnels that cause severe uplift on the edges and ridges of residential roofs.
Heavy Spring Deluges
Massive volumes of water in short periods that overwhelm compromised gutters and roof valleys.
